Elisabeth Garouste (born 1946 in Paris) is a French designer and interior architect. She studied at École Camondo and is known for her imaginative and often playful forms inspired by art, literature, and mythology.
Mattia Bonetti (born 1952 in Lugano, Switzerland) is a Swiss designer who began his career in textiles and photography before transitioning to furniture and object design.
Together, they founded the studio Garouste & Bonetti in Paris in 1981. Their work is characterised by sculptural forms, craftsmanship, and a blend of historical references and modern design. The style has been referred to as "Barbarian style."
